Output 4dada81f2ed7d980d94c60cf874f26ed349171b4d3f9d6e5f366fd029f54ee7a:6

value
27693611
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9699838cb0829e16702a4161507d2b45a7ed8d6a OP_EQUAL
address
MMdTVXzPrkKpy7pnVskTFeqT93qmKHX3hn
transaction
4dada81f2ed7d980d94c60cf874f26ed349171b4d3f9d6e5f366fd029f54ee7a
spent
true